Look for Commercial-Specific Experience
Residential plumbing is very different from commercial plumbing. A plumber who mainly works on homes may not be equipped to handle the demands of a multi-floor office or food service facility. Commercial jobs usually require knowledge of industrial-grade materials, building codes, and emergency repair protocols.
When interviewing plumbers, ask how much experience they have with properties like yours. A hospital has very different needs from a shopping center. Someone who’s worked in your specific industry before will better understand your requirements and compliance needs.
Verify Licenses and Insurance Coverage
Commercial plumbing work requires special certifications in San Diego. Always check that the plumber holds a valid California contractor’s license. This ensures they meet the training and safety standards set by the state. Insurance is just as important. It protects your property and business from damage or injury claims.
Always ask to see valid insurance papers, including general liability and workers’ compensation. Any licensed commercial plumber will be happy to provide these documents. Without them, you could be held financially responsible for accidents or mistakes on your property.

Review Industry-Specific Services Offered
Different industries in San Diego rely on specialized plumbing services. A good commercial plumber will offer more than just pipe repairs. Make sure they can handle the unique challenges your industry faces, such as:
- Grease trap installation and cleaning for restaurants
- Medical gas line repair for healthcare facilities
- Industrial drain system maintenance for factories
- Backflow testing and certification for office buildings
- Water heater and boiler system upgrades for schools or hotels
Ask for a detailed list of services they provide and match it to your operational needs. The right plumber won’t just fix problems but help prevent them, too.
